Apr 28, 2024  
2021-2022 Westminster College Catalog 
    
2021-2022 Westminster College Catalog [ARCHIVED CATALOG]

CS 152 - Principles of Computer Science II

Semester Hours: 4

A continuation of the study of the discipline of computer science. This course includes an introduction to data structures, simulation, and scientific uses of computing. Programming for searching and sorting data is covered, as well as an introduction to recursion. A continuation of CS 151  using application development as a vehicle to teach more advanced programming skills. Topics may include mobile application development (especially for Android and iOS), an introduction to data structures, recursion, object-oriented programming patterns, software testing, graphical user interfaces, elementary graphics and game development, network programming.

Prerequisite: CS 151 .
When Offered: (Offered Spring semester.)